Mort: "Ahhh... Krystallnacht!"
Krystallnacht aka “Night of Broken Glass” took place in Nazi Germany November 7, 1938, it saw the destruction of more than a thousand Synagogues, the ransacking of tens of thousands of homes, and more than 30,000 Jewish men taken away to concentration camps.
